Your campaign launched. The budget is gone. The report is full of impressions and clicks. But in a consumer health, beauty or lifestyle market, those metrics mean nothing if nobody can name what your brand stands for. Features and ingredients don't differentiate. A hundred other products have the same claims. What separates winning brands is a clear belief system. The product is just how a customer joins. When your ads, emails and posts each say something different, you don't build recognition. And now, AI assistants recommend brands they can define. If your brand isn't one of them, you're invisible.

Fixing this isn't about spending more on ads. It's about taking a step back before you spend anything. You need to define the one idea your brand owns. That work might take a few focused weeks. The scope depends on how scattered your current messaging is and how many channels you're trying to fix. If your website says one thing, your social feeds another, and your retail listings a third, the work is bigger. If you have a founder with a strong point of view, that can speed things up. The investment is in clarity, not in more ad dollars.

is linkedin good for b2b marketing

LinkedIn works when the message is specific to one buyer and one problem, and the landing page keeps the promise. Generic campaigns pay LinkedIn prices for nothing. Position first, then the campaign.

how to measure marketing campaign effectiveness

Measure campaigns against pipeline and closed deals, not clicks. Agree the numbers with sales before launch, and report them in plain language leadership can act on.
